Trivia
-
The case itself is a
nifty double sided job. If you open it from the spine, it opens to
reveal the ‘contents’ side of the packaging. If you flipped it over, and
pushed against the ‘front’ of the case, you could open either panel and
get access to the PSone demo or the PS2 demo.
-
In a rather cute moment
of catch-22, the animated host comments about how you can witness the
PS2 launch by watching the PS2 disc, except you can only do that if you
have a PS2, which would have meant you'd already have been there to see
the system launched.
-
Most Underground Demos
had secret codes that could be entered to reveal hidden gems on the
disc. Each issue of UG that followed would then show what the codes were
for the previous issue. Was a rather unique way to revisit something you
probably wouldn't look at again.
